| def text_to_parsed_content(text : String) : JSON::Any | ||||
|   nodes = [] of JSON::Any | ||||
|   # For each line convert line to array of nodes | ||||
|   text.split('\n').each do |line| | ||||
|     # In first case line is just a simple node before | ||||
|     # check patterns inside line | ||||
|     # { 'text': line } | ||||
|     currentNodes = [] of JSON::Any | ||||
|     initialNode = {"text" => line} | ||||
|     currentNodes << (JSON.parse(initialNode.to_json)) | ||||
|  | ||||
|     # For each match with url pattern, get last node and preserve | ||||
|     # last node before create new node with url information | ||||
|     # { 'text': match, 'navigationEndpoint': { 'urlEndpoint' : 'url': match } } | ||||
|     line.scan(/https?:\/\/[^ ]*/).each do |urlMatch| | ||||
|       # Retrieve last node and update node without match | ||||
|       lastNode = currentNodes[currentNodes.size - 1].as_h | ||||
|       splittedLastNode = lastNode["text"].as_s.split(urlMatch[0]) | ||||
|       lastNode["text"] = JSON.parse(splittedLastNode[0].to_json) | ||||
|       currentNodes[currentNodes.size - 1] = JSON.parse(lastNode.to_json) | ||||
|       # Create new node with match and navigation infos | ||||
|       currentNode = {"text" => urlMatch[0], "navigationEndpoint" => {"urlEndpoint" => {"url" => urlMatch[0]}}} | ||||
|       currentNodes << (JSON.parse(currentNode.to_json)) | ||||
|       # If text remain after match create new simple node with text after match | ||||
|       afterNode = {"text" => splittedLastNode.size > 0 ? splittedLastNode[1] : ""} | ||||
|       currentNodes << (JSON.parse(afterNode.to_json)) | ||||
|     end | ||||
|  | ||||
|     # After processing of matches inside line | ||||
|     # Add \n at end of last node for preserve carriage return | ||||
|     lastNode = currentNodes[currentNodes.size - 1].as_h | ||||
|     lastNode["text"] = JSON.parse("#{currentNodes[currentNodes.size - 1]["text"]}\n".to_json) | ||||
|     currentNodes[currentNodes.size - 1] = JSON.parse(lastNode.to_json) | ||||
|  | ||||
|     # Finally add final nodes to nodes returned | ||||
|     currentNodes.each do |node| | ||||
|       nodes << (node) | ||||
|     end | ||||
|   end | ||||
|   return JSON.parse({"runs" => nodes}.to_json) | ||||
| end | ||||
